10 October 2020, Shenzhen, China - ZTE Corporation (0763.HK / 000063.SZ), a major international provider of telecommunications, enterprise and consumer technology solutions for the Mobile Internet, together with Informa Tech and leading analyst firm Omdia, has a held global online webinar on "MEC Technology Innovation and Multi-Field Applications". 

Julian Watson, Principal Analyst, IoT at Omdia , and Riki Yang, Technical Director of Cloud & Core Network Products, ZTE Corporation, have conducted an in-depth discussion on the industry landscape and prospect of MEC. In addition, Riki Yang has introduced ZTE's solution innovations and practices in MEC. 

In the keynote speech, Julian Watson, pointed out that, more than two thirds of enterprises with IoT deployments have treated 5G and edge computing as their strategic priorities, according to Omdia's 2019 enterprise IoT survey. 

Riki Yang explained that MEC plays a role of a hub connecting telecoms operators and Internet services. MEC should be able to adapt to complex environments, facilitate installation and O&M, reduce latency, save transmission, and better support vertical industries and Internet services. 

Furthermore, MEC will also break the closed telecoms network architecture and provide telecoms capability APIs (such as TCPO, LBS and QoS) for third parties, so as to increase network profit and better support services. 

"In the Internet field, MEC can simultaneously provide VMs, containers and bare metal resources. Moreover, it can introduce cloud native technologies into existing NFV and third-party applications. Existing Internet applications can be seamlessly migrated to MEC edge cloud, which extends public cloud services, such as cloud gaming and AR/RV, to the operators' MEC to better meet ultimate service experience requirements of ultra-low latency and ultra-large bandwidth,” said Riki Yang. “Based on the operators' 5G slicing technology, MEC provides high-quality private network assurance for industry users, thus building a dedicated industry network.”

To date, ZTE has developed more than 500 industry customers to build a win-win MEC ecosystem, in cooperation with major global operators in many fields, including industrial control, Internet of Vehicles, smart finance, smart agriculture, smart power, smart sports and entertainment, smart security, and smart health care, so as to accelerate digital transformation of various industries.
